数据库什么是计数值类型

worktile 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,计数值类型是用来存储整数值的一种数据类型。计数值类型通常用于存储需要进行计算和统计的数据,例如记录数量、计数器值、投票数等。

    以下是关于计数值类型的五个重要特点:

    1. 整数值存储:计数值类型只能存储整数值,不能存储小数或者其他非整数类型的值。这是因为计数值类型主要用于计算和统计,而整数值在这些操作中更加方便和高效。

    2. 存储空间节省:计数值类型通常会占用比其他数据类型更少的存储空间。这是因为整数值的表示范围相对较小,所以可以使用较少的字节来存储。例如,一个计数值类型可能只需要1个字节来存储,而其他数据类型可能需要更多的字节。

    3. 整数运算:计数值类型支持常见的整数运算操作,包括加法、减法、乘法和除法。这使得在数据库中对计数值类型进行计算和统计更加方便和高效。例如,可以使用计数值类型来计算两个记录的差异或者计算某个字段的总和。

    4. 索引支持:计数值类型可以作为索引的一部分,以提高查询性能。通过将计数值类型作为索引列,可以更快地定位和访问数据库中的特定记录。这对于需要频繁进行计数和统计操作的数据库非常有用。

    5. 数据完整性:计数值类型还可以用于实现数据完整性约束。通过设置计数值类型的最小值和最大值,可以限制字段中存储的值的范围。这可以确保存储的值始终在预期的范围内,避免了数据不一致或者错误的情况。

    总的来说,计数值类型在数据库中扮演着重要的角色,用于存储和处理需要进行计算和统计的整数值。通过使用计数值类型,可以更高效地进行数据操作和查询,并确保数据的完整性和一致性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,计数值类型是一种用于存储整数值的数据类型。它主要用于存储和处理与计数相关的数据,例如记录数量、计数器、票数等等。

    数据库中常见的计数值类型包括整型(INT)、小整型(SMALLINT)、大整型(BIGINT)等。这些类型的取值范围和存储空间大小不同,可以根据具体需求选择合适的类型。

    整型是最常用的计数值类型,它通常用于存储正整数或负整数。整型的取值范围取决于具体的数据库管理系统,一般情况下,INT类型的取值范围为-2,147,483,648到2,147,483,647,而BIGINT类型的取值范围更大,为-9,223,372,036,854,775,808到9,223,372,036,854,775,807。

    小整型是一种较小的整数类型,通常用于存储较小范围内的整数。它的取值范围为-32,768到32,767,比整型占用更少的存储空间。

    大整型是一种较大的整数类型,通常用于存储较大范围内的整数。它的取值范围比整型更大,可以存储更大的整数值。

    除了整型、小整型和大整型,还有其他一些计数值类型,如TINYINT、MEDIUMINT等,它们的取值范围和存储空间大小也不同,可以根据实际需求来选择适合的类型。

    使用计数值类型可以有效地存储和处理计数相关的数据,同时还可以进行各种数学运算,如加法、减法、乘法、除法等。在数据库中,计数值类型是非常常用和重要的一种数据类型,广泛应用于各种数据库管理系统中。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,计数值类型是一种用于存储整数值的数据类型。计数值类型通常用于存储计数、数量、索引等整数值。

    常见的计数值类型有以下几种:

    1. 整数类型(INT):整数类型是最常见的计数值类型之一,用于存储不带小数部分的整数。根据所占字节的不同,整数类型可以分为TINYINT、SMALLINT、MEDIUMINT、INT和BIGINT等多种类型。

    2. 浮点数类型(FLOAT和DOUBLE):浮点数类型用于存储带有小数部分的数值。FLOAT类型可以存储单精度浮点数,而DOUBLE类型可以存储双精度浮点数。浮点数类型通常用于存储需要高精度计算的数值,如科学计算、金融等领域。

    3. 小数类型(DECIMAL):小数类型也用于存储带有小数部分的数值,但相比于浮点数类型,小数类型可以指定精度和小数位数。DECIMAL类型通常用于存储货币和其他需要精确计算的数值。

    4. 布尔类型(BOOLEAN):布尔类型用于存储逻辑值,只能取两个值之一:TRUE或FALSE。布尔类型通常用于存储逻辑判断的结果。

    5. 位类型(BIT):位类型用于存储二进制位序列。BIT类型可以指定位数,常用于存储标志位、权限控制等数据。

    在数据库中,计数值类型的选择应根据具体的业务需求和数据特性来确定。例如,如果需要存储小数值并要求高精度计算,可以选择DECIMAL类型;如果只需要存储整数值,可以选择INT类型;如果需要存储逻辑判断结果,可以选择BOOLEAN类型等。正确选择合适的计数值类型可以提高数据存储效率和查询性能,并确保数据的准确性和一致性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部